In the Rough. Ceramic cutting tools are just for roughing, according to Benkóczy. Because of the severe tool wear ceramic tools experience, such as chipping of the cutting edge and a significant reduction in the tool radius, they can continue to perform roughing but are not suitable for finishing. Use a more positive geometry. Preferable use 65/60/45 degree cutters. If cutting fluid must be used to avoid dust, etc. choose the wet milling grades. Coated carbide is always the first choice, but ceramics can also be used. Note that the cutting speed, vc, should be very high, 800–1000 m/min (2624–3281 ft/min).

Usual Problems. One of the biggest problems in aluminum cutting is the Built Up Edge. The built up edge is a welding of workpiece material to the tool edge that commonly occurs on soft, gummy workpiece materials and the loss of effective geometry causes increases in cutting forces and quality problems. _. Coating PVD Definition and properties. Physical Vapor Deposition (PVD) coatings are formed at relatively low temperatures (400-600°C). The process involves the evaporation of a metal which reacts with, for example, nitrogen to form a hard nitride coating on the cutting tool surface.

Metal Finishing Systems l 1-800-747-2637 Introduction to Buffing "Buffing" is the process used to shine metal, wood, or composites using a cloth wheel impregnated with cutting compounds or rouges. The cloth buff "holds" or "carries" the compound, while the compound does the cutting.

Operators can't be too careful in selecting abrasives for these tools. A typical straight-shaft grinding tool has a maximum speed of 1,600 RPM; Fein's MSh 635 die grinder achieves 48,000 RPM. This is a speed differential of 30-to-1. Any tool intended for a maximum of 1,600 RPM would likely disintegrate at 48,000 RPM, and injuries could result.

Aug 15, 2011· Edge angles define the tool's shape as seen from the top of the tool. They vary with the purpose of the tool and also by how much strength is needed at the tip. Tools meant for heavy cuts, like a rougher, will have more mass at the tip to handle higher cutting loads, while a finishing tool will have a more delicate tip appropriate to the lighter cuts it is meant to take.

M42HSS bit with 5% cobalt. Sharpen like for finish cut on steel, or (alternately) with some side sheer and a largish nose radius. Stone the edge to a good polish. Any DOC you want. Fine step over. Use ATF for cutting fluid, run shaper as fast as it will go without rocking. You'll get an irridescent polished finish looking better than ground.

Aug 30, 2018· Lapping is a controlled sanding or polishing process that creates an accurate finish on a part. The result is a precise roughness on flat or domed surfaces. Flat lapping can correct surface irregularities caused by sawing or grinding. Domed lapping produces a slender, uniform shape for
